Output d6e8c32041c55bfea15b5232fc3d9746d8565ecdbae75be838f160e6a1a66f1f:48

value
1427085
script pubkey
OP_0 OP_PUSHBYTES_20 41cdf6395501e55a1f61cfa92b68214c0044420b
address
bc1qg8xlvw24q8j458mpe75jk6ppfsqygsstvpx5sq
transaction
d6e8c32041c55bfea15b5232fc3d9746d8565ecdbae75be838f160e6a1a66f1f
confirmations
198094
spent
true